Distribution of plutonium in Lake Michigan sediments
A study was conducted to obtain baseline information as to the present content of Pu in sediment from Lake Michigan, to determine the utility of Pu isotopes for estimating sedimentation rates, to assess the extent of additional radionuclide inputs to Lake Michigan from nuclear power plants and other sources, and to determine the vertical distribution in recent sediments. Tables are presented to show sedimentation rates and calculated mixing depths, flux normalization factors, and total activity of $sup 239$Pu, $sup 240$Pu, $sup 137$Cs, and $sup 210$Pb in sediment cores taken in 1972, 1973, and 1974. Graphs are presented to show measured $sup 137$Cs, $sup 239$Pb, and $sup 240$Pu profiles in sediment cores and sedimentary columns at various stations during 1972, 1973, and 1974. The significance of the results is discussed. (HLW)
